What a read! Set in dusty small town America in the 1950's, this unique murder mystery begins with all the "family values" front and center. But then the veneer begins to peel off, exposing the inner lives of utterly memorable characters who run the gamut from psychotic to genuinely loving. In two words, it's nostalgic and creepy. Unlike most mysteries, we know who did it, but are wrapped up in the character's lives all the more because they don't know what we know - and are in danger.
